New Ultra HiRF EMC Horn Antenna Capability Announced

by James Hinton last modified Wed 29 August 2007 16:34

Q-par Angus was proud to officially launch it's new HiRF Antenna Capability, at the 2006 EMC UK exhibition. This new HiRF (High Intensity Radiated Field) achieves new levels of high field strength, in excess of 3 kV/m @ 1m, across the 0.4 - 18 GHz band.

New Ultra HiRF EMC Horn Antenna Capability Announced

1.5 to 2 GHz HiRF Array System

With ever increasing field strengths required to meet the latest EMC test standards, Q-par Angus Ltd has taken the initiative. In doing so, we have developed a unique antenna system that is capable of reaching ultra high field strengths in the near field that will never be attainable using traditional systems.

This novel approach makes use of arrays, lenses and extended gain antennas to achieve high field strength in the near field. Traditional EMC antennas fail to produce the necessary gain to meet with the latest high power specifications. These latest specifications drove Q-par to strive forward and develop this system drawing on it's long history of designing custom antenna solutions, and working closely with our customers.

By teaming up with TMD technologies, the microwave amplifier manufacturers, we have been able to produce complete turn-key High Power EMC Test Systems achieving high gain in the near field with a workable spot size.
